Program Description
The Entrepreneurship program is designed to provide learning opportunities for students that have a desire to become entrepreneurs and attain self-sufficiency. The Entrepreneurship program provides learning opportunities that will assist in planning as it relates to owning and operating a business, marketing concepts, licensing, financing, accounting, record keeping systems, and the legal aspects of owning and operating a business. High school graduation or GED is required for gradation from this program.
Employment Opportunities
The Entrepreneurship program prepares the student for self-sufficiency as related to owning and operating one's own business.
